编程教育机器人什么意思

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程教育机器人是指一种具有教育功能的机器人,旨在通过与学生互动和教学来教授编程知识和技能。它可以是一种物理机器人,也可以是一个虚拟实体,通过软件和互联网进行交互。编程教育机器人通常具有以下特点和功能:

    1. 互动学习:编程教育机器人通过与学生进行互动,提供实时反馈和指导,帮助学生理解编程概念和解决问题。

    2. 编程语言学习:它可以教授不同的编程语言,如Python、Java、Scratch等,帮助学生掌握编程的基本语法和逻辑。

    3. 项目实践:编程教育机器人通常提供一系列的编程项目,学生可以通过完成这些项目来应用所学的知识,培养实际编程能力。

    4. 可视化编程:为了让学生更容易理解和学习编程,编程教育机器人通常采用可视化编程工具,如图形化编程界面,使编程过程更直观和易于操作。

    5. 创意编程:一些编程教育机器人还鼓励学生进行创意编程,通过设计和编写自己的程序来实现创造性的想法和项目。

    6. 团队合作:编程教育机器人还可以促进学生之间的合作和团队工作,通过共同解决问题和完成编程任务来培养团队合作能力。

    编程教育机器人的目的是帮助学生培养计算思维、逻辑思维和问题解决能力,为他们未来的学习和职业发展打下基础。通过与机器人互动学习编程,学生可以更加主动地参与学习,提高学习效果和兴趣。同时,编程教育机器人也可以为教育者提供一个辅助教学的工具,帮助他们更好地教授编程知识和技能。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程教育机器人是一种用于教授编程和计算机科学知识的机器人。它们被设计用于帮助学生学习编程的基本概念和技能,包括算法、逻辑思维、问题解决和创造性思维等。这些机器人通常具有友好的外观和交互方式,可以通过编程指令来控制它们的行为,从而让学生亲身体验编程的过程。

    以下是关于编程教育机器人的五个重要点:

    1. 亲身实践:编程教育机器人为学生提供了一个可以直接实践编程技能的平台。学生可以通过编写程序代码来控制机器人的行为,从而使他们能够看到自己的代码如何影响机器人的动作和反应。这种实践性的学习方式可以帮助学生更好地理解编程概念,并培养他们的问题解决和创造能力。

    2. 互动性和趣味性:编程教育机器人通常具有友好和可爱的外观,以及丰富多样的交互功能,使学习过程更有趣。这些机器人可以与学生进行对话、回答问题,甚至展示一些有趣的动作和表情。这种互动性和趣味性可以激发学生的兴趣和动力,使他们更愿意投入到学习编程的过程中。

    3. 多样化的教学内容:编程教育机器人通常提供了多种不同难度和类型的编程任务和挑战。学生可以从简单的基础编程开始,逐渐提升到更复杂的编程项目。这种多样化的教学内容可以满足不同学生的学习需求和能力水平,使每个学生都能够找到适合自己的学习路径。

    4. 团队合作和交流:编程教育机器人可以鼓励学生之间的团队合作和交流。学生可以组成小组,共同编写程序代码来控制机器人的行为,从而培养他们的团队合作和沟通能力。这种合作和交流的过程不仅可以加强学生的编程技能,还可以培养他们的领导能力和解决问题的能力。

    5. 实际应用和职业发展:学习编程不仅可以帮助学生培养创造力和解决问题的能力,还可以为他们提供未来职业发展的机会。编程教育机器人可以通过实际应用场景的模拟和项目实践,帮助学生将编程技能应用到现实生活中。这种实践经验可以为学生在未来的职业发展中提供宝贵的经验和竞争优势。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程教育机器人是指一种能够帮助儿童和青少年学习编程的机器人。它结合了机器人技术和编程教育的理念,旨在通过与机器人的互动和编程实践,培养学生的逻辑思维、创造力和解决问题的能力。

    编程教育机器人通常具有以下特点:

    1. 互动性:编程教育机器人具备与学生进行互动的能力,可以通过语音、触摸、手势等方式与学生进行交流。学生可以通过与机器人的互动来实践编程技能,并从机器人的反馈中学习和调整自己的编程代码。

    2. 编程能力:编程教育机器人可以通过编程语言或图形化编程界面进行编程,学生可以通过编写代码来控制机器人的动作、行为和反应。机器人可以执行学生编写的程序,并将结果反馈给学生。

    3. 多功能性:编程教育机器人通常具有多种功能和传感器,可以执行不同的任务和动作。例如,机器人可以根据学生的指令行走、转向、跳跃等,还可以感知环境中的声音、光线、颜色等信息,并做出相应的反应。

    4. 创造性:编程教育机器人鼓励学生进行创造性思维和创新实践。学生可以设计和编程机器人完成各种有趣的任务和项目,如迷宫探索、舞蹈演出、足球比赛等,从而培养学生的创造力和解决问题的能力。

    编程教育机器人的操作流程通常包括以下几个步骤:

    1. 选择机器人:根据学生的年龄、编程经验和学习需求,选择适合的编程教育机器人。市面上有许多不同类型和品牌的编程教育机器人可供选择,如LEGO Mindstorms、mBot等。

    2. 学习编程知识:在使用编程教育机器人之前,学生需要学习一些基本的编程知识和概念,如算法、循环、条件语句等。可以通过参加编程课程、阅读编程教材或在线学习资源等方式来学习。

    3. 编写程序:学生可以使用编程软件或编程工具来编写机器人的控制程序。对于初学者,可以使用图形化编程界面来拖拽和连接代码块,简化编程过程。对于有一定经验的学生,可以使用文本编程语言来编写更复杂的程序。

    4. 调试和测试:在编写完程序后,学生需要进行调试和测试,确保程序的正确性和机器人的正常运行。学生可以逐步执行程序的各个步骤,观察机器人的反应和动作,并根据需要进行调整和修改。

    5. 实践和创造:一旦程序调试通过,学生可以将机器人放入实际的场景中进行实践和创造。他们可以设计和编程机器人完成各种任务和项目,并通过不断的实践和尝试来提升自己的编程技能。

    总之,编程教育机器人是一种结合了机器人技术和编程教育的工具,通过与机器人的互动和编程实践,培养学生的编程能力、创造力和解决问题的能力。通过学习和使用编程教育机器人,学生可以在动手实践中提升自己的编程技能,并培养创造性思维和解决问题的能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部